What pads and discs are recommend for the DC5's ??

I can get hold of EBC redstuff thought my work but they don't list anything for the disc's!!

I'm getting slight brake fade under heavy breaking, its only just come off the boat from japan and discs don't seem to be cleaning up very well so gonna put new all round.

Dont get redstuff pads all they do is make a lot of dust, get Ferodo DS2500's and Brembo slotted discs.

EBC are rubbish IMO!

OEM Brembo from honda (not eBay) all round.
Change your fluid to something of good quality as it could've been in there years!..
Fit TGM braided lines the same time..
And there you have a quality day to day / fast road brake set up :)
